Ingredients
- 2 chicken thighs or breasts, cut into pieces
- 1/4 cup soy sauce
- 2 tbsp brown sugar
- 3 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 tbsp fresh ginger, grated
- 1 cup chicken broth
- 2 cups cooked rice
- 1 tbsp sesame seeds
- 2 tbsp chopped green onions
Instructions
- Cook rice and set aside.
- Sear chicken in skillet until golden.
- Add soy sauce and brown sugar, cook until chicken is caramelised.
- Simmer chicken broth with garlic and ginger to create fragrant broth.
- Serve rice topped with broth, caramelised chicken, sesame seeds, and green onions.
Notes
- Marinate chicken for extra flavor.
- Add steamed veggies to make it more filling.
- Use tamari for a gluten-free version.
